Teamviewer versus **Third Party Product**

Just a few observations about Teamviewer versus **Third Party Product**. I am unimpressed with the latter. **bleep** doesn't allow you to see the cursor on the remote machine, while TV does. That is, there is one cursor, not two. That's a bother if you're trying to see what a user on the remote machine is doing, and are "looking over their shoulder". Also (and a BIG issue), the **bleep** connection is disabled if the remote machine does a restart. That is, if the remote machine has a power failure, followed by automatic restart, you will not be able to do a **bleep** connection to it without having someone there to enable it. TV is wonderful in that it can enable itself after a restart. Online reviews of TV versus **bleep** never refer to these points.
